Hello Jose,
below is something for GNU LilyPond. Werner ====================================================================== LilyPond is a music engraving program, devoted to producing the highest-quality sheet music possible. It brings the aesthetics of traditionally engraved music to computer printouts. LilyPond is free software and part of the GNU Project. Project site: https://lilypond.org/ Adding variants of font glyphs ------------------------------ * Adding 'on' and 'between' staff-line variants. * Shorter and narrower variants of some glyphs (for example, accidentals). Another, more specific example could be an ancient notation breve notehead coming in two variants, one with a small and one with a big 'hole' within it. Difficulty: easy/medium Size: 175h/350h Required skills: MetaFont, C++, good eye for details Contact: 'lilypond-devel@gnu.org' mailing list (https://lists.gnu.org/mailman/listinfo/lilypond-devel) Recommended knowledge: basic LilyPond knowledge More GSoC ideas: https://lilypond.org/google-summer-of-code.html